HomePath homes are usually more affordable than standard-market homes, but they’re also sold in as-is condition. Web11 jan. 2024 · Fannie Mae HomePath is a unique foreclosure-sale program backed by mortgage giant Fannie Mae. Through HomePath, renters and buyers can purchase foreclosed or distressed homes at significant discounts to fair market value. HomeReady is a conventional mortgage loan provided under Fannie Mae guidelines that only requires a 3% down payment to purchase a home and affordable refinance options. HomeReady offers lower monthly mortgage insurance and better rates for those that qualify. WebFuture homebuyers also tend to finance an FHA or HomeReady mortgage because it allows borrowers to make a down payment less than the standard 20 percent. With an FHA loan, borrowers can make a down payment as little as 3.5% if their credit score is greater than 580, or up to 10% if their credit score is between 500 and 579. WebHomeReady income limits. Fannie Mae sets income limits for its HomeReady program. To qualify, you can’t make more than 80% of your area’s median income (AMI).
